A bulb of power 60 W is used for 12.5 h each day for 30 days. Calculate the electrical energy consumed.

Given,

Power (P) = 60 W

time (t) = 12.5 h for 30 days

As energy consumed (E) = P × t

E=60×12.5E=750 WhE = 60 \times 12.5 \\[0.5em] \Rightarrow E = 750 \text { Wh}

Hence, electrical energy consumed in one day = 750 Wh

Electrical energy consumed in 30 days = ?

E=750×30E=22500 WhE=22.5 kWhE = 750 \times 30 \\[0.5em] E = 22500 \text { Wh} \\[0.5em] E = 22.5 \text { kWh} \\[0.5em]

Hence, electrical energy consumed in 30 days = 22.5 kWh
